WebIf you intend to cut meat and vegetables on the butcher block, then it’s important to use food-safe finishes. Use a butcher block oil that is labeled as food safe. Flood the surface with oil on both faces. Wipe away the excess oil. You may need to apply several coats for maximum penetration. WebJul 31, 2024 · You can safely use pure tung oil to finish a cutting board (or any other food-related project) as it’s completely natural and food-safe. Tung oil has many other benefits alongside being food-safe, such as being very easy to apply, protecting the wood from scratches, and waterproofing the wood.

Vegetable Oils Olive oil, corn oil, and sunflower oil, should neverbe used to maintain a cutting board or butcher block. As touched on above, these oils experience rancidification – a process that yields a rank smell and unpleasant taste. As a cutting board touches your food, substances that can turn rancid should … See more Mineral Oil Mineral oil (sometimes called liquid paraffin) is a non-toxic, non-drying product derived from petroleum that is colorless, odorless, and flavorless. WebJun 8, 2002 · Canola, olive, safflower, and several other types of oils will turn rancid. However, almond oil does not turn rancid, and is an excellent choice to finish cutting boards. You don't need anything special, just buy almond oil from the grocery store and wipe it on.
